is a powerful macro automation tool for jailbroken iOS devices, using a "cracked repo" to obtain it is generally discouraged due to significant security and stability risks. What is AutoTouch?

AutoTouch is a macro utility that allows users to record and playback touch actions and physical button presses. It uses Lua scripts to automate complex tasks, making it popular for repetitive gaming actions or workflow efficiency. Review of "Cracked Repos" for AutoTouch Cracked repositories (like

) provide paid tweaks for free by bypassing their license checks. Security Risks

: Cracked repos are often unverified and have a history of hosting malware. Notable examples like the KeyRaider malware stole data from over 225,000 devices via pirated tweaks. Stability Issues

: Pirated versions are frequently outdated. Using an older version of AutoTouch on a newer iOS version can lead to "respring loops" or "boot loops," potentially forcing you to restore your device and lose your jailbreak. Lack of Support

: Official developers do not provide support for cracked versions, and many pirated tweaks may fail to function correctly because they cannot reach official license servers. Official and Safe Alternatives

While the allure of free premium software is strong, downloading cracked tweaks involves significant risks to your device's security and stability. 📱 What is AutoTouch?

AutoTouch is a "record and play" tweak for jailbroken iOS devices. It allows users to: Record physical screen touches and button presses. Play back those actions in a loop.

Script complex workflows using the Lua programming language.

Automate repetitive tasks in games, social media, or productivity apps.

Unlike simple auto-clickers, AutoTouch can read pixel colors on the screen, allowing the script to "react" to changes, such as clicking a button only when it turns green. ⚠️ The Dangers of Using a Cracked Repo

Searching for an "AutoTouch cracked repo" usually leads to third-party sources like HackYouriPhone or Kiiimo. While these repositories are famous, they carry inherent dangers: 1. Malware and Backdoors

Cracked tweaks are modified by anonymous third parties. They can easily bundle spyware or keyloggers into the package. Since jailbreaking grants root access to your file system, a malicious tweak can steal your: Apple ID credentials. Banking information. Private photos and messages. 2. System Instability

Cracked versions are often outdated. They may not be optimized for the latest version of Dopamine, Palera1n, or Rootless jailbreaks. This frequently leads to:

Respring loops (where the phone gets stuck on the Apple logo). High battery drain. Random app crashes. 3. Lack of Script Library Access

The official AutoTouch app includes a cloud store where users share powerful scripts for popular games. Cracked versions are often blocked from these servers, leaving you with the tool but no community-made scripts to run on it. 🛠️ The Official Way to Install AutoTouch

The Risks of Using AutoTouch Cracked Repos AutoTouch is a powerful macro automation tool for jailbroken iOS devices, allowing users to record and play back touch actions. While it is a premium tweak available through the Official AutoTouch Repo, many users seek out "cracked" versions from third-party repositories to avoid the license fee. However, using these unofficial sources comes with significant security and stability risks. Why Avoid Cracked Repos?

Malware and Security Threats: Third-party repositories like HackYouriPhone (HYI) or Rejail often host pirated content that may be injected with malware, keyloggers, or spyware. These can compromise your sensitive data, including passwords and banking information.

System Instability: Cracked versions of AutoTouch are frequently outdated or improperly modified, leading to frequent crashes, boot loops, or incompatibility with newer iOS versions and jailbreak environments like Sileo or Zebra.

No Developer Support: When you use a legitimate version from the AutoTouch Team, you gain access to official documentation, updates, and community support via Discord or Reddit. Cracked versions receive no such updates, leaving you vulnerable to bugs.

License Verification Issues: AutoTouch uses a server-side license check. Most cracked versions attempt to bypass this, which can result in the app suddenly stopping or scripts failing to run halfway through. How to Safely Install AutoTouch

The Technical Reality: How Cracks Work (And Fail)

Legitimate AutoTouch uses a server-side license check. When the tweak loads, it pings the developer's server to verify your device UDID (Unique Device Identifier) is registered.

A cracked version typically works in one of three malicious ways: None are as powerful as AutoTouch

  1. Local Certificate Spoofing: The crack installs a fake local server that tells AutoTouch the license is valid. This often breaks after a reboot.
  2. Binary Patching: The cracker removes the license check lines from the code. This is difficult and often introduces bugs.
  3. DRM Removal via Substrate: A secondary tweak disables the license framework. This is the most common method—and the most dangerous.
